Abstract:
Abstract The Euler gamma-function Γ(s) usually plays an important role in the theory of zeta-functions. It is a principal ingredient of functional equations, and therefore the behaviour of zeta-functions are influenced by properties of Γ(s). For the convenience, in this chapter we recall some elements from the theory of the gamma-function.
